BC Timber Sales (BCTS) is a unique program of the Ministry of Forests (FOR). Working collaboratively with regional and district operations, BCTS plans, develops, and auctions a substantial portion of the province’s annual available timber volume. BCTS operations are guided by three overarching principles, forest sector safety, reconciliation with Indigenous Peoples and sustainable forest management.

This position is focused on leading and managing the operational and non-operational training aspects of the Forest Technologist Entry Level Program (FTELP) and directly supervising up to 6 staff. This includes designing and implementing specialized operational projects, delivering specialized training, consulting with other subject matter experts, planning and organizing training sessions, and providing expert advice and mentoring to trainee forest technologists.
